Compare Hot Springs to Pine Bluff
This post compares Hot Springs, Arkansas to Pine Bluff, Arkansas across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.
Dimension | Hot Springs (city) | Pine Bluff (city) |
---|---|---|
Population | 36,780 | 44,509 |
Income (median) | $33,060 | $34,299 |
Home Value (median) | $114,700 | $73,700 |
White | 73% | 19% |
Black | 17% | 77% |
Asian | 0% | 0% |
With Kids | 23% | 30% |
Age (median) | 41 | 34 |
Rentals | 45% | 45% |
